Early Signing Day proved to be an early start again as recruits and programs looked for the first signee to kick off a busy day around the country.
There were plenty of early headlines to watch as news came into program facilities around 7 a.m. ET on Wednesday.
A Florida 5-star commit said he would not sign on Wednesday after all. Meanwhile, South Carolina picked up a surprise addition to its class from a former Texas A&M commit.
There are still several moving parts around the league and country, but the players below are known commodities as their paperwork has been sent in and verified, and they’re ready to get to work.
Here’s the first recruit to sign with each team in the SEC:
Alabama
Justin Okoronkwo, linebacker, Munich, Germany.
